Treatment Overview

Y-Flap Breast Reconstruction in Korea is an advanced surgical technique used to reconstruct the breast using a Y-shaped tissue flap, often harvested from the patient’s own body. This procedure is commonly applied in autologous breast reconstruction following mastectomy, providing a natural breast shape and contour while minimizing donor site complications.

Recovery & Aftercare

  • Hospital stay typically 3–5 days for monitoring flap viability
  • Light activities can resume in 1–2 weeks
  • Avoid strenuous exercise or heavy lifting for 6–8 weeks
  • Compression garments are recommended for donor and breast sites
  • Regular follow-up visits ensure flap integration, symmetry, and proper healing

Cost Range

The cost of Y-Flap breast reconstruction in Korea varies depending on complexity, donor site, and combination procedures:

  • Standard Y-Flap Reconstruction: ₩15,000,000 – ₩25,000,000 KRW
    (Approx. $11,500 – $19,000 USD)
  • Combination with Fat Grafting or Implant: ₩20,000,000 – ₩35,000,000 KRW
    (Approx. $15,200 – $26,600 USD)
  • Optional Nipple Reconstruction or Secondary Touch-Ups: ₩3,000,000 – ₩6,000,000 KRW
    (Approx. $2,300 – $4,500 USD)

Additional Costs:

  • Pre-operative consultation and imaging: ₩200,000 – ₩500,000 KRW ($150 – $380 USD)
  • Hospital stay and medications: ₩2,000,000 – ₩5,000,000 KRW ($1,500 – $3,800 USD)
  • Follow-up visits and secondary procedures: ₩200,000 – ₩800,000 KRW ($150 – $610 USD)
